About The Position

We are seeking an Events Coordinator to be the driving force behind our team's daily operations. This role presents a fantastic opportunity to support engineering and research success in the Austin area, shaping the experiences of our employees.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's or associate degree, or an equivalent combination of education, training, and experience.
  • Years of experience in operations management and execution.
  • Exceptional influence and collaboration skills, with the ability to work collaboratively across a highly matrixed organization.
  • Aptitude for independent work without significant oversight, achieving results with accuracy and attention to detail under deadline pressure.
  • Event Management & Logistics
  • Budget & Financial Management
  • Marketing & Promotion: 4+ years
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, project management, Excel data entry, calendar management, and customer service.
  • Experience in corporate events, trade shows, and project coordination.

Responsibilities

  • Support the Engineering Site Leader in maintaining a rhythm of business that drives execution of core business priorities and encourages best practice sharing among engineering sites.
  • Participate in strategic initiatives or cross-group projects by contributing to the overall strategy, creating and implementing plans, and developing metrics and communication approaches.
  • Partner with corporate communications and local teams to deliver on internal and external communication strategies that reinforce values, brand, and community presence.
  • Collaborate with leaders, HR, and diversity and inclusion champions to shape and influence a positive, inclusive, and innovative culture at our engineering sites.
  • Deliver programs in support of strategic initiatives or cross-group projects, contributing to the overall strategy for engaging communities and ecosystems in the region.
  • Maintain relationships with peers outside the team to ensure strong cross-group collaboration.
  • Partner with the Finance team and business program managers to support financial planning and budgeting, participating in expense reporting, budget tracking, and reconciliation activities.
  • Plan and execute meetings, events, and partnerships both internally and with external partners.
  • Continuously seek ways to simplify processes and drive improvements and efficiencies.
  • Exercise sound judgment, tact, diplomacy, integrity, confidentiality, and professionalism in all communications and interactions.
